Bellandur lake foams again, froth flies in the face of citizens
Light showers that came as a respite to the whole of Bengaluru, became a bane to the residents of Bellandur. While the burning sun is raising a stink from the heavily polluted Bellandur lake, the light showers resulted in the froth on Sunday and Monday. Despite a temporary grill that the civic authorities have erected near the lake, froth flew past the grill and landed on commuters using the stretch of road near the lake.
Unchecked affluents continue to choke the already dying lake of Bellandur with civic authorities doing precious little to clean or revive it. The recent video of foam flying into the face of citizens comes days after a video of the lake on fire went viral. Each time a frothing incident takes place, the government including the civic authorities and district in-charge minister make fresh promises, none of which have materialised.

Taking note of the cringeworthy state of the lake, the national green tribunal has asked Karnataka government to file replies on a PIL that was filed. The Namma Bengaluru Foundation, a civic NGO had impleaded that the fire incident in February was not a lone incident and several instances of major or minor fire had been reported from the lake due to the burning of solid municipal waste, garbage in the lake catchment.
